Understanding the Landscape of Local SEO in the UK

Before delving into affordable strategies, it's important to understand the crucial components of local SEO within the UK context. While many SEO concepts are universal, particular nuances are especially pertinent to the UK market:

  • Google My Business (GMB): This totally free tool is probably the cornerstone of local SEO. Enhancing your GMB profile is paramount. It's the very first impression lots of local clients will have and straight impacts presence in Google Maps and local search packs. A total, accurate, and engaging GMB profile, rich with pictures, business details, and consumer interaction, signals to Google that your business is legitimate and appropriate to local searches.
  • Local Citations: These are online mentions of your business's name, address, and contact number (NAP) throughout the web. Citations function as online validation, proving to search engines that your business is a genuine entity in the city. UK-specific directories and online platforms are crucial targets for building citations.
  • UK-Focused Online Directories: Beyond generic directory sites, focusing on UK-centric platforms like Thomson Local, Yell.com, Scoot, and local business directories can significantly increase local visibility. Consistency of NAP info across these platforms is essential.
  • Local Keyword Research: Understanding how local consumers search is necessary. This includes recognizing keywords with local intent, incorporating location modifiers (e.g., "Indian dining establishment Birmingham", "plumbing professional near me London"), and understanding the local search terms used within your specific niche in the UK.
  • On-Page Local SEO Optimization: Your website needs to be enhanced for local searches. This consists of including location-based keywords into page titles, meta descriptions, headings, and website content. Developing localized landing pages targeting particular services and places within the UK further reinforces your local SEO efforts.
  • Reviews and Reputation Management: Online reviews are extremely prominent for local businesses. Encouraging satisfied clients to leave evaluations on Google My Business and other platforms builds trust and signals quality to both possible clients and search engines alike. Actively handling and reacting to reviews, both favorable and unfavorable, is important.
  • Mobile Optimization: With a substantial portion of local searches performed on mobile devices, ensuring your website is mobile-friendly is non-negotiable. Google prioritizes mobile-first indexing, indicating the mobile version of your site is the main version considered for indexing and ranking.

Effective & & Affordable Local SEO Strategies for UK Businesses

The excellent news is that accomplishing significant local SEO gains in the UK does not demand a fortune. Here are actionable, affordable strategies UK businesses can carry out:

1. Mastering Google My Business Optimization (Free):

  • Claim and Verify Your Listing: Ensure your GMB listing is claimed and properly verified. This is the very first and most important step.
  • Complete All Sections Thoroughly: Fill in every area of your GMB profile with accurate and comprehensive info. This consists of business name, address, contact number, website, business hours, categories, qualities (e.g., wheelchair available, complimentary Wi-Fi), and an engaging business description.
  • Top Quality Photos and Videos: Upload high-resolution images and videos showcasing your business, products, services, team, and place. Visual content significantly improves your profile's appeal and engagement.
  • Frequently Post Updates: Use GMB Posts to share news, uses, occasions, and blog site content straight on your profile. Regular publishing keeps your profile fresh and interesting for both users and Google.
  • Engage with Customer Reviews: Actively react to customer reviews, both favorable and unfavorable. Thank customers for favorable feedback and address issues constructively in negative reviews.
  • Use GMB Q&A: Monitor and address questions in the Q&A section of your GMB profile. Proactively populate it with FAQs to deal with common customer queries.

2. Building Local Citations Strategically (Low Cost):

  • Focus on High-Authority UK Directories: Prioritize listings on reliable UK directory sites like Yell.com, Thomson Local, Scoot, Yelp (UK), and local business directories relevant to your industry and area.
  • Consistency is Key: Ensure your NAP (Name, Address, Phone Number) corresponds across all citation sources. Inconsistencies can confuse search engines and negatively impact your local SEO.
  • Explore Free Citation Opportunities: Many free online directories and platforms provide citation chances. Start with these to develop a foundation before thinking about paid alternatives.
  • Niche-Specific Directories: Identify industry-specific directories appropriate to your business in the UK (e.g., directory sites for dining establishments, plumbings, legal representatives, and so on). These frequently bring more weight for local SEO within your particular niche.
  • Consider Local Chamber of Commerce Listings: Listing your business with your local Chamber of Commerce can offer valuable local citations and networking opportunities.

3. Local Keyword Research and On-Page Optimization (DIY or Low Cost Tools):

  • Brainstorm Local Keywords: Think like your local consumer. What terms would they use to search for your services or products in your area?
  • Make Use Of Free Keyword Research Tools: Leverage totally free tools like Google Keyword Planner (with a Google Ads account), Ubersuggest (complimentary version), and Google Trends to identify pertinent local keywords and understand search volume.
  • Enhance Website Content: Incorporate local keywords naturally into your website content, including page titles, meta descriptions, headings (H1s, H2s), image alt text, and body text.
  • Create Location-Specific Landing Pages: Develop dedicated landing pages for each product or service you provide, targeting particular places in the UK you serve.
  • Localize Website Content: Add location mentions throughout your website content where appropriate, referencing your city, town, or area naturally within the text.

Determining the Success of Your Affordable Local SEO Efforts:

Tracking your progress is vital to ensure your affordable local SEO strategies are yielding results. Secret metrics to keep track of include:

  • Google My Business Insights: Track metrics within your GMB control panel, such as searches, views, website clicks, call, and instructions demands.
  • Website Traffic: Monitor your website traffic from organic search, focusing on local keyword traffic utilizing Google Analytics.
  • Local Keyword Rankings: Track your rankings for target local keywords utilizing rank tracking tools (lots of offer totally free or affordable plans).
  • Inbound Leads and Sales: Monitor the number of leads and sales generated from local search queries.
  • Customer Reviews: Track the number and quality of customer evaluations on Google My Business and other appropriate platforms.
